£14K should get you a good standard car, nothing in it between the BT & ST in standard form on the reliability front. A lot depends on how well the car has been looked after. The BT can be better power wise because of the standard turbos size compared to the ST & gives scope for cheap power, but the ST is a better everday car I'd say.

Depends on what you call long periods. Some don't like being left for a week others can go months. Just one of those things I guess. Mine stays on the drive all year round & gets started / driven every week. Not seen a problem like some have that posted on here after being left in the garage over winter.
